Chrome's useful mute tab feature could be making a comeback

Evidence points to a return of the convenient audio control

Do you remember when you could easily mute a tab playing audio in Chrome without going to it and manually fiddling with the player on that page? Google inexplicably removed the ability to do this back in 2018. Thankfully, it looks likely that the feature will be making a comeback.

According to a Chromium Gerrit update spotted by Redditor u/Leopeva64-2, Google is "bringing this back." This doesn't mean that it will definitely arrive in a near-future Chrome update, but simply that it is planned at some point (and obviously, plans can change).
